Smart Weather Condition Sensors
Smart climate sensing units have actually reinvented the effectiveness of modern-day watering systems by adjusting watering timetables based on real-time environmental information. These sensors keep an eye on variables such as temperature level, moisture, wind rate, and solar radiation, permitting systems to react dynamically to altering climate condition. By incorporating this information, clever sensing units can enhance water usage, reducing waste and making sure that landscapes obtain the ideal amount of moisture. This innovation not only saves water however also promotes healthier plant development by protecting against overwatering or underwatering. Furthermore, the automation provided by clever weather condition sensors improves customer convenience, as house owners and landscaping companies can depend on exact watering timetables without manual intervention. Generally, these innovations stand for a considerable innovation in lasting irrigation methods.

Dirt Dampness Sensors
Soil moisture sensing units play an important role in modern watering systems, supplying real-time data that enhances water efficiency. These devices gauge the volumetric water material in the soil, permitting accurate assessments of moisture degrees. By incorporating dirt dampness sensing units into watering systems, users can prevent overwatering or underwatering, ultimately promoting much healthier plant growth and conserving water resources.The sensing units transmit information to controllers, which can readjust watering schedules based upon present soil problems. This data-driven strategy lessens water waste and guarantees that plants obtain the ideal quantity of moisture. Furthermore, soil dampness sensing units can be helpful in different farming settings, from home yards to massive farms. The deployment of these sensing units contributes to lasting methods by sustaining responsible water usage and decreasing environmental effect. In general, the incorporation of dirt moisture sensing units marks a substantial improvement in attaining reliable irrigation systems.

What Is the Lifespan of Modern Automatic Sprinkler Elements?
The lifespan of contemporary automatic sprinkler parts generally ranges from 5 to 20 years, depending upon the materials used, upkeep methods, and environmental problems. Routine maintenance can considerably boost durability and performance with time.
